Mercury Mail Services is a Direct Mail and printing company operating continuously for more than 20 years. We print, address, and mail cards for non-profit charitable organizations throughout the country who operate household donation pickup programs as part of their fundraising program.
The Direct Mail Coordinator is a key position that serves as the contact for current and new customers as well as vendors such as the U.S. Postal Service, in-house and off-site printers, and paper suppliers.
Duties:
- Coordinate the printing and mailing schedule for customers each week, ensuring that supplies, artwork, and postal forms are in place and on time.
- Order paper and other office supplies, ensuring that paper rolls for printing by off-site printers are always in stock and delivered to printers in a timely manner.
- Order printed cards for each customer from off-site printer weekly, ensuring that quantities are accurate and print jobs are delivered to Mercury Mail’s in-house printer for addressing on time to meet mailing schedules.
- Develop artwork for customers’ blank template cards using Adobe products like InDesign Illustrator and Photoshop.
- Ensure accurate and timely postage payment by using BCC Mail Manager to transfer raw data to printable format ready to upload to Postal One, a U.S. Post Office product used to pay the postage for all mailing jobs.
- Serve as Mercury Mail’s key contact with the U.S. Postal Service, specifically the Bulk Mail Department.
- Serve as key contact for potential and new customers, providing information on Mercury Mail’s process for scheduling and mailing.
- Work as a team with GIS Specialist who oversees truck routing for customers, and President to ensure smooth operations and excellent customer service.
- Miscellaneous duties as assigned.
